## v0.9.0 — Setting renamed for user module split

As part of carving the user module out of the Hollowgate monolith into the new Userforge service, `MONO_USER_SECRET` has been renamed to `USERFORGE_SERVICE_SECRET`. The old name is no longer read anywhere. Update each environment's `.env`: remove the old line, then add the renamed secret entry immediately after `USERFORGE_BASE_URL`.

secret setting of tawif-tajop: COURIER_KEY13=819c65d82d2bd

Ticket for weekly sync: the Tallowmere metrics-aggregation sidecar (Countinghouse) can't fetch its scrape credentials because the Ironbell vault locked itself after the cert rotation on Monday. Dashboards are stale, alerts are blind. Fix is easy but gated: someone with unseal rights runs the Ironbell recovery flow and supplies the passphrase, which for the record is the one right below.

strongbox words: zordor-quenax

Handover — Vexler partner SFTP drop

Ownership moves to you today. Drop runs hourly from Vexler's end into the intake bucket via the relay host. Watch for zero-byte files; their exporter flakes on Mondays. Creds live in the ops vault, path noted in the runbook. Vault auto-seals after 48h idle. Support escalations go to the on-call rotation, not me. If the vault is sealed when you need it, unseal with the recovery passphrase below.

recovery phrase for tadug-fafof: zorwyn-kasion

During the Tidegate rollout framework upgrade to 3.2, the staging boxes in the Ostermere cluster began rejecting flag evaluations with signature errors. Root cause: the provisioning script copied `env.sample` instead of the populated `.env`, so the signing credential was blank. For future maintainers: any host running the Tidegate evaluator must have this value set before the daemon starts, or flags silently fall back to defaults. To fix, open `/etc/tidegate/.env` and append the following line:

sealed setting: ARCHIVE_KEY3=8d0